The Complex Event Processing Market grew from USD 457.45 million in 2024 to USD 481.65 million in 2025. It is expected to continue growing at a CAGR of 5.24%, reaching USD 621.77 million by 2030.

Setting the Stage for Complex Event Processing Excellence

In an era defined by accelerating data streams and the ever-growing need for real-time decision making, complex event processing has emerged as a pivotal technology for organizations seeking to detect patterns, respond to anomalies, and extract value from torrents of information. By ingesting, filtering, correlating, and analyzing events as they occur, this discipline empowers businesses to optimize operations, mitigate risks, and deliver superior customer experiences with unprecedented speed.

Navigating the Transformative Shifts Reshaping Event Processing

The landscape of event processing is experiencing a profound transformation driven by advances in data generation, analytics, and infrastructure. As organizations embrace digital transformation initiatives, the proliferation of connected devices, sensors, and transaction systems has created an environment in which real-time insights are not merely advantageous but essential. Edge computing architectures are pushing processing closer to data sources, enabling instantaneous analysis and decisioning at the network periphery. At the same time, integration of artificial intelligence and machine learning capabilities into event processing platforms is amplifying the ability to detect subtle patterns, predict outcomes, and automate complex workflows.

Moreover, containerization and microservices are revolutionizing deployment flexibility, allowing enterprises to scale event processing workloads seamlessly across public clouds, private datacenters, and hybrid environments. The rise of streaming data frameworks such as Apache Kafka and Flink underscores a shift away from batch-oriented processing toward continuous ingestion and analysis pipelines. Concurrently, heightened concerns around data privacy and security are driving demand for robust governance frameworks and compliance capabilities within event processing solutions.

These converging trends are redefining the criteria by which organizations select and implement complex event processing technologies, elevating requirements for interoperability, low latency, fault tolerance, and extensibility. As a result, providers are racing to innovate modular architectures that support both real-time analytics and business-critical applications, ensuring that event-driven intelligence can be embedded seamlessly into enterprise operations.

Assessing the Cumulative Impact of U.S. Tariffs on Event Processing Dynamics

The imposition of new United States tariffs in 2025 represents a critical inflection point for the event processing market, with cascading effects on hardware suppliers, cloud service providers, and end-user adoption. Tariffs targeting imported semiconductors and networking equipment have introduced cost pressures that are prompting some vendors to reevaluate supply chains and negotiate alternative procurement arrangements. These measures have also influenced global sourcing strategies, encouraging partnerships with domestic manufacturers and spurring investments in localized production facilities.

In parallel, increased duties on cloud infrastructure components are contributing to elevated subscription fees for certain managed event processing services. Some providers have responded by optimizing resource utilization through advanced container orchestration, thereby mitigating cost increases and preserving competitive pricing models. End users, particularly in heavily regulated industries, are exercising greater scrutiny over total cost of ownership and seeking transparent tariff pass-through policies from their vendors.

Beyond hardware and services, the tariff landscape is shaping decisions around multi-cloud and hybrid-cloud architectures, as organizations weigh the trade-offs between geographic diversity, latency considerations, and fiscal efficiency. The net result is a market characterized by cautious investment, selective deployment, and an unwavering focus on maximizing return on event processing infrastructure. Strategic suppliers who can demonstrate resilience against tariff volatility and deliver predictable performance will gain a decisive advantage in this evolving environment.

Contextualizing Regional Variations in Event Processing Adoption

Regional dynamics in complex event processing adoption reflect a blend of technological maturity, regulatory frameworks, and economic priorities. In the Americas, rapid cloud uptake, robust financial services ecosystems, and strong innovation hubs have accelerated deployment of event-driven architectures in industries ranging from fintech to healthcare. Meanwhile, Europe, the Middle East & Africa are guided by stringent data sovereignty regulations and a growing emphasis on digital transformation in public services, energy, and manufacturing, fostering demand for secure and compliant event processing platforms.

Across Asia-Pacific, significant investments in smart cities, telecom infrastructure, and e-commerce are driving a surge in real-time analytics use cases. Governments and enterprises in the region are leveraging event processing to optimize traffic management, enhance retail personalization, and improve operational resilience amid expanding urbanization. The confluence of competitive telecommunications providers and a vibrant startup ecosystem is further catalyzing innovation, ensuring that Asia-Pacific remains one of the fastest-growing markets for event-centric intelligence.
